Aruba is pretty easy to get around but it is essential to rent a car. WebApr 12, 2024 · Roundabouts in Aruba are very common. That's why it's very important to know the roundabout traffic rules. On roundabouts the traffic approaching the roundabout must yield to traffic that's already on the roundabout. In other words traffic on the roundabout has the right of way and drivers entering the circles must wait for an opening. WebOct 11, 2024 · Aruba is a small island, so it should be easy to get around.
